✏️Anchor Charts Topics:

•Types of Informational Text (narrative, expository, persuasive and procedural)

•Text Feature Overview (organize text, graphics, fonts and facts)

•Organize Text (table of contents, index, glossary, heading/subheadings

•Graphics (photographs, illustrations, diagrams, labels, captions)

•Fonts (bold, italics, color, size, underline)

•facts (maps, tables or charts, graphs, timeline)
